Assisted Living in Lakeland, FL

Lakeland is a city in central Florida that got its name from the 38 lakes within the city limits, including Lake Morton, Lake Parker and Lake Mirror. It has a population of approximately 112,000 people, with nearly 22% aged 65 and older. There are plenty of things to see and do, including long walks in Hollis Garden, taking in a baseball game at the Joker Merchant Stadium or taking a tour of the Frank Lloyd Wright Museum at Florida Southern College.

For seniors, assisted living facilities offer a middle ground between nursing homes and aging at home. By surrounding residents with supportive caregivers and peers, assisted living facilities help seniors with daily needs and opportunities to socialize. According to Genworth’s 2021 Cost of Care Survey, in Lakeland, the average monthly assisted living rate is $3,300, a figure lower than the averages of Florida, the nation and many of Lakeland’s regional neighbors.

The Cost of Assisted Living in Lakeland

With its average monthly assisted living cost of $3,300, Lakeland stands out as an affordable option. Florida’s statewide average of $4,000 is $700 higher, and the national average of $4,500 is $1,200 higher.

Lakeland is also a competitive choice compared to neighboring cities. It is slightly more affordable than Sebastian, Tampa and Punta Gorda, which share an average assisted living cost of $3,350 per month. Sebring’s average fee is not far off from those, coming in at $3,436. However, prices are higher in Orlando. There, the average assisted living community charges $4,000. North Port’s median rate is $4,145, exceeding Lakeland’s by $845. Seniors in Palm Bay pay an even higher average fee of $4,461. Finally, in The Villages, the average assisted living resident pays $5,208, representing a $1,908 jump over Lakeland’s typical rate.

Lakeland Assisted Living Resources

ContactDescription
Lakeland Activity Center for Seniors(863) 687-2988Designed to meet the needs of individuals aged 55 and older, the Lakeland Activity Center provides a range of activities in a safe environment. Activities include card games, arts and crafts, exercise classes, musical entertainment, computer classes and bingo twice a week. Day trips are also planned on a regular basis.
Lakeland Vet Center(863-284-0841The Lakeland VA Center provides medical care and other essential services to those who have served in the military and their families. The center also helps veterans sign up for school or training, obtain home loans, insurance and other compensation. The VA also connects families with national cemeteries and burial services.
Polk County Area Agency on Aging(813) 740-3888The Area Agency on Aging helps connect seniors with the available resources throughout the area. These resources may include information about state and federal benefits, long-term care centers and assistance navigating the insurance options.
Polk County Elder Helpline(800) 336-2226The Elder Helpline provides information to seniors within the county on available services and scheduled activities, including information about the local food program, health care, federal programs, housing and nutrition.
Long-Term Care Ombudsman(850) 414-2000The Florida Long-Term Ombudsman Program (LTCOP) is a statewide program that serves as an advocate for seniors who live in long-term care facilities. The program investigates problems and issues that arise in facilities and helps resolve complaints. The program also conducts annual assessments of long-term facilities within the network.
